Synonym: ceremony, spectacle. Antonym: simplicity, plainness

Meaning: elaborate display or ceremony

Pageantry meaning


Pageantry is a word that is often associated with grandeur, elegance, and spectacle. It refers to the elaborate display of ceremonies, traditions, and performances that are typically seen in formal events, such as parades, beauty contests, or royal processions. If you are looking to incorporate this word into your writing, here are some tips on how to use "pageantry" effectively in a sentence:


1. Definition: Begin by providing a clear definition of the word "pageantry" to ensure that your readers understand its meaning.

For example, "Pageantry, defined as the extravagant display of ceremonies and traditions, adds a touch of opulence to any event."


2. Formal events: Pageantry is often associated with formal events, so it is important to use it in the context of such occasions. For instance, "The royal wedding was a perfect example of pageantry, with its grand processions, ornate decorations, and regal attire."


3. Descriptive language: When using the word "pageantry," try to incorporate descriptive language to paint a vivid picture for your readers.

For example, "The pageantry of the carnival was a feast for the senses, with vibrant costumes, lively music, and exuberant dancers filling the streets."


4. Historical context: Pageantry has a rich history, so consider incorporating this aspect into your sentence. For instance, "The pageantry of the ancient Roman gladiator games captivated the crowds, as they witnessed fierce battles unfold in the grand amphitheater."


5. Symbolism: Pageantry often carries symbolic meaning, so try to highlight this aspect in your sentence.

For example, "The pageantry of the changing of the guard ceremony symbolizes the continuity and strength of the nation's military."


6. Cultural significance: Pageantry varies across different cultures, so you can use this word to explore cultural traditions. For instance, "The pageantry of the Chinese New Year celebrations showcases the rich cultural heritage of the country, with dragon dances, fireworks, and vibrant displays of red and gold."


7. Emotional impact: Pageantry can evoke strong emotions, so consider incorporating this aspect into your sentence.

For example, "The pageantry of the memorial service brought tears to the eyes of the attendees, as they witnessed the solemn rituals and heartfelt tributes."


8. Contrast: Pageantry can be used to create a contrast between different elements. For instance, "The simplicity of the countryside wedding stood in stark contrast to the pageantry of a royal wedding, yet both held their own charm and beauty."


9. Positive connotations: Pageantry is often associated with positive attributes, so try to highlight these qualities in your sentence.

For example, "The pageantry of the opening ceremony showcased the country's rich cultural heritage, leaving the audience in awe of its beauty and grandeur."


10. Metaphorical use: Pageantry can also be used metaphorically to describe situations or events that are characterized by a sense of grandeur or showmanship. For instance, "The CEO's presentation was filled with pageantry, as he captivated the audience with his charismatic presence and compelling storytelling." Incorporating these tips into your writing will help you effectively use the word "pageantry" in a sentence, allowing you to convey its meaning and create a vivid image for your readers.
